Decoding Backpack Materials: Weight and Durability

When choosing a light backpack, material matters! Many brands tout “lightweight” but sacrifice durability. Nylon and polyester are common choices, with nylon often slightly lighter but potentially less water-resistant unless treated. Think about those unexpected rain showers during your commute – you’ll want something that can withstand a bit of drizzle.

Ripstop nylon is a popular choice because of its impressive strength-to-weight ratio. The weave pattern prevents tears from spreading, making it a durable option for everyday use. Polyester is often more budget-friendly and offers decent water resistance, making it a solid option if you’re looking to save some cash.

Consider the denier (D) rating of the fabric. This refers to the thickness of the threads. A higher denier generally means a more durable fabric, but also a heavier one. Finding the sweet spot between weight and durability is key. For example, a 210D ripstop nylon might be a good balance for everyday use.

Ultimately, researching the materials used and reading reviews about the backpack’s durability are crucial steps. Don’t just go for the lightest option without considering how well it will hold up to your daily grind. A durable, lightweight backpack is an investment that will last for years to come.

Maximizing Space in Your Light Backpack: Packing Strategies

Okay, you’ve got your light backpack. Now, how do you actually fit everything in without overstuffing and defeating the purpose? Packing efficiently is key! Start by laying out everything you think you need, and then critically evaluate each item. Can anything be left behind? Do you really need that bulky textbook, or can you use an ebook version?

Rolling your clothes instead of folding them is a classic space-saving trick. This minimizes wrinkles and allows you to fit more items into tight spaces. Utilize every nook and cranny. Socks and underwear can be stuffed into shoes, and small items like chargers can be tucked into side pockets.

Consider investing in packing cubes. These help organize your belongings and compress them into smaller bundles. They also make it easier to find what you’re looking for without having to rummage through your entire backpack. Imagine arriving at a conference and being able to quickly access your presentation materials without creating a chaotic mess.

Don’t forget about weight distribution. Place heavier items closer to your back to maintain balance and prevent strain. This will make carrying your backpack much more comfortable, especially during long commutes. By mastering these packing strategies, you can make the most of your light backpack’s limited space and avoid unnecessary bulk.

Maintaining Your Light Backpack: Cleaning and Care Tips

So, you’ve found the perfect light backpack. Now, let’s talk about keeping it in tip-top shape! Regular cleaning and proper care will extend its lifespan and keep it looking its best. Think of it as an investment in your comfort and style.

First, check the manufacturer’s instructions for specific cleaning recommendations. Some backpacks can be machine washed, while others require hand washing. If machine washing, use a gentle cycle and mild detergent. Always air dry your backpack to prevent damage from high heat.

For spot cleaning, a damp cloth and mild soap are usually sufficient. Pay attention to areas that tend to get dirty, like the bottom of the backpack and the shoulder straps. Consider using a stain remover specifically designed for fabrics.

Store your backpack in a cool, dry place when not in use. Avoid leaving it in direct sunlight or damp environments, as this can damage the fabric and cause mildew. Periodically check for any signs of wear and tear, such as loose seams or broken zippers, and address them promptly to prevent further damage. Taking these simple steps will keep your light backpack looking and functioning its best for years to come.

Laptop Protection: Keeping Your Tech Safe and Sound

For many, a laptop is an essential work tool, and its safety is paramount. A dedicated, padded laptop compartment is non-negotiable. Make sure it’s the right size for your laptop – check the dimensions carefully. Look for features like a suspended laptop sleeve, which elevates your laptop slightly off the bottom of the bag, providing extra protection against accidental bumps.

Think about the overall construction of the laptop compartment. Is it well-padded on all sides? Does it have a secure closure, like a buckle or Velcro strap, to prevent your laptop from shifting around during transit? Some backpacks even offer additional features like reinforced corners or water-resistant zippers to further protect your valuable tech. You’ll want to look for one of the best light backpacks for work that prioritizes laptop safety above all else.

What size backpack should I get for work?

Choosing the right backpack size really depends on what you typically carry each day. If you’re mostly hauling around a laptop, a few files, and maybe a water bottle, a smaller backpack in the 15-20 liter range could be perfect. It’ll be lightweight and won’t encourage you to overpack! However, if you also need space for gym clothes, lunch, or a larger laptop, you might want to consider something in the 20-30 liter range.

Think about your daily essentials and maybe even lay them out to get a visual idea of how much space they take up. Don’t forget to consider if you’ll need extra room for occasional items like a rain jacket or a book. Ultimately, you want a backpack that comfortably fits your belongings without feeling bulky or weighing you down.

Are there specific backpack materials that are better for durability?

Absolutely! The material of your backpack plays a significant role in its durability. Nylon is a popular choice because it’s lightweight, water-resistant, and relatively abrasion-resistant. Ballistic nylon is even tougher, making it a great option for heavy-duty use. Ripstop fabrics are designed to prevent tears from spreading, adding another layer of protection.

Polyester is another common material that’s durable and water-resistant, although it might not be as abrasion-resistant as nylon. When choosing a backpack, pay attention to the denier (D) rating of the fabric – a higher denier indicates a thicker, more durable material. Look for backpacks with reinforced seams and sturdy zippers for added longevity.

What’s the difference between a women’s-specific and a unisex backpack?

Women’s-specific backpacks are designed with the female anatomy in mind, offering a more comfortable and ergonomic fit. They typically have narrower shoulder straps that are contoured to better fit the shoulders, a shorter torso length, and a hip belt that’s shaped to fit the hips more comfortably.

While unisex backpacks can certainly work for women, a women’s-specific model can provide a more comfortable and secure fit, especially for longer commutes or when carrying heavier loads. Consider trying on both types to see which feels best for your body type and preferences. The goal is to find a backpack that fits well and distributes weight evenly to minimize strain.
